Stefan's Armors 'N' Items: Rename to Transform Gear

Every Minecraft player knows the moment when the shine of a full diamond set starts to fade. The grind for resources becomes routine, and the crafting table loses its magic. Stefan's Armors 'N' Items: Rename to Transform Gear, crafted by the developer StefanJ2_, addresses this exact fatigue with an elegant twist on a core vanilla mechanic. Instead of introducing new ores, complex machinery, or multi-block structures, this modification turns the humble anvil into a gateway for discovering entirely new equipment. The concept is deceptively simple: rename an existing piece of armor or a tool with a specific word, and the game transforms it into a unique item with its own appearance and stats.

The Core Concept: Words as Crafting Recipes

The brilliance of Stefan's Armors 'N' Items: Rename to Transform Gear lies in its seamless integration with vanilla gameplay. The anvil has always allowed players to rename items, but this mod expands the dictionary of accepted names. When you place an iron chestplate, a diamond sword, or leather boots into the anvil and type a registered name, such as "Shadow Blade" or "Crystal Chestplate," the item undergoes a transformation. No additional materials are required, only experience levels. This design respects the player's existing inventory and encourages experimentation without demanding a checklist of obscure resources.

How the Transformation Works

The process is intuitive for any veteran player. You approach the anvil, insert your base item, and input a name from the mod's catalog. Upon confirmation, the item's model, texture, and attributes change instantly. The experience cost is reasonable, scaling with the power of the resulting gear. This system effectively hides a vast array of recipes within the game's language, rewarding players who are curious enough to test different combinations. The mod listens for the rename event and swaps the item if the input matches a registered keyword, making the underlying code lightweight and efficient.

What You Can Unlock: A Catalog of Transformed Gear

Stefan's Armors 'N' Items: Rename to Transform Gear covers all standard material tiers, from leather and iron to gold, diamond, and netherite. For each tier, the mod offers a diverse selection of alternative sets. The variety ensures that players at any stage of the game can find something new to pursue.

  • Elemental Armor: Fire, ice, and storm-themed suits that alter not only defensive values but also produce visual effects during movement, such as embers trailing behind the player.
  • Thematic Sets: Knight, assassin, and royal ensembles, each with a distinct silhouette that changes how your character appears to other players and mobs.
  • Hybrid Tools: Pickaxes, axes, and swords that glow in dark areas, apply status effects to enemies on hit, or accelerate block-breaking speeds.
  • Secret Renames: Pop-culture references, hidden easter eggs, and humorous items that require deep experimentation to discover, adding a layer of mystery to the mod.

The complete list of available renames is published by the author on the official project page and is updated regularly. Additionally, the mod ships in several editions: a base version and various add-ons that introduce more options for specific materials or aesthetic styles. This modular approach lets you control how much content you want to add to your game.

Balance and Compatibility: A Fair Addition

One of the most common pitfalls for armor mods is power creep. Stefan's Armors 'N' Items: Rename to Transform Gear avoids this by keeping the stats of transformed items comparable to their vanilla counterparts. The benefits are usually subtle, such as a slight increase in durability, a minor speed boost, or resistance to a specific damage type. This ensures that the mod enhances gameplay without making the player invincible, preserving the challenge and integrity of the base game.

Compatibility is another strong suit. Because the mod does not generate new blocks, alter world generation, or modify existing interfaces, it coexists peacefully with most popular mod packs. It simply hooks into the anvil's rename event, making it a safe addition even to heavily modded playthroughs. This stability is a significant advantage for players who enjoy large, complex mod collections.

Tips for Master Renamers

To get the most out of this mod, consider these practical suggestions:

  • Maintain a healthy reserve of experience levels. Some transformations require up to 30 levels, so a trip to an experience farm before a major upgrade session is wise.
  • Mix and match pieces from different sets. Wearing a helmet from one set with a chestplate from another can create unexpected and appealing visual combinations.
  • Keep an eye on updates. The author frequently adds new names and adjusts the balance of existing ones, so checking the project's news feed is worthwhile.
  • Explore the add-ons. If the base version feels limited, installing additional content packs multiplies the available options, providing hundreds of new gear variations.
